Background
The crop straw belongs to a valuable biomass energy resource in an agricultural ecological system. The comprehensive utilization of the crop straw resources has great significance for promoting the income increase of farmers, protecting the environment, saving the resources and developing the sustainable agriculture economy. Wherein, the straws can be processed into straw pellet fuel, straw feed and other materials. After the straw is smashed and made into particles, the straw needs to be bagged and conveyed to a thermal power plant and the like for use, and after the bagging is completed, the packaging bag needs to be packaged by using a straw particle packaging bag sealing device.
At present, the existing bagging machine has single function, can only complete a packaging task, and is very complicated in weighing and calculation after packaging; the device has a complex structure, so that the whole device can not be flexibly controlled manually during operation, empty package is easy to cause, packaging materials are wasted, the weight of the package can not be recorded during packaging, and the device needs to be weighed independently at the later stage, so that the efficiency is low, the cost is high, and time and labor are wasted; and the finished product of the straw particles is generally higher in temperature, needs to be cooled separately, carries a lot of production dust, and is not environment-friendly and attractive enough to be directly bagged.

Referring to fig. 1 to 3, the present invention provides a technical solution: a finished product bagging machine for preparing straw particle fuel materials comprises a device body 1, wherein a feed inlet 2 is fixedly arranged at the top of the device body 1, straw particle finished products are poured into the device body 1 through the feed inlet 2, a buffer plate 15 is arranged inside the device body 1, the top end of the buffer plate 15 is located below the center of the feed inlet 2 and used for buffering the impact of the poured straw particle finished products on the inner portion of the device and a feeding blade 5, an air blower 3 is arranged at the upper right end of the device body 1 and used for cooling particle finished products and removing dust, a dust-proof bag 4 is fixedly connected to the outer end of the air blower 3, a conveying belt 12 is arranged at the bottom of the device body 1 and can convey bagged packages to a sealing position, a motor 7 is arranged at the end of a tubular part extending out of the left end of the device body 1, a motor switch 71 is arranged on the motor 7 in the direction of an, the right end of a feeding shaft 6 is inserted into the device body 1, two ends of the feeding shaft are connected with the device body 1 through bearings, a plurality of feeding blades 5 are spirally distributed on the feeding shaft 6, the outer diameters of the feeding blades 5 are in clearance fit with the inner side of the left end tubular part of the device body 1, a discharging port 8 is installed below the end of the left end tubular part of the device body 1, the discharging port 8 is inserted into a charging belt 11, the charging belt 11 is located above a conveying belt 12, a bagging support 14 is located behind the conveying belt 12, and an indicator lamp 13 is higher than the left end protruding part of the device body 1 and located behind the device body 1.
Furthermore, the material containing bag 11 is clamped by an upper bag clamping ring 9 and a lower bag clamping ring 10, a convex part at the end part of the upper bag clamping ring 9 is movably connected with a synapse at a corresponding position of the lower bag clamping ring 10 through a pin, and a round hole in the middle of the lower bag clamping ring 10 is movably connected with the synapse at a corresponding position of the bag containing bracket 14;
further, an indicator light 13 is installed at the right end of the top of the bagging support 14, an indicator light switch 131 is installed below the corresponding position, when the loading belt 11 is loaded to a specified weight, the other end of the lower bag clamping ring 10 is lifted, the middle rod portion is jacked to the indicator light switch 131, the indicator light switch 131 is located right above the lower bag clamping ring 10, and the indicator light 13 is on to indicate that bagging is completed;
the working principle is as follows: during the use, pour the straw granule finished product into device body 1 inside from feed inlet 2, the granule finished product reaches the bottom pay-off part through buffer board 15, and in-process air-blower 3 will cool off the granule finished product and detach unnecessary dust and collect to in dust bag 4, guarantee the feature of environmental protection of working process, install the charging belt 11 and smuggle the part secretly, namely between upper bag clamping ring 9 and lower bag clamping ring 10, install the benchmark bag in the other end smuggle the part secretly in advance, place the charging belt 11 sack in discharge gate 8 below, press motor switch 71, when pilot lamp 13 is bright, close motor switch 71, open upper bag clamping ring 9, the charging belt 11 of dress is transported to the department of sealing along with conveyer belt 12.
